Description

Explore a definitive version of Jeremy Bentham's work with The Book of Fallacies. This edition from Oxford University Press is the first to follow Bentham's original structure, providing a more accurate look at his reasoning. Unlike previous versions that omitted significant material, this volume includes a wide range of fallacies and illustrative examples that were previously lost to readers. Bentham focused on a specific type of error: the arguments used in political debate to block reform. Rather than looking at basic logical errors or simple misunderstandings of facts, this work examines the tactics used in the British Parliament. It provides a deep look at how arguments were deployed to prevent social and political progress. This book is an essential resource for those studying legal history, political science, and the evolution of debate.
